Subject: Handover — Lanternmoss wiki access

Hi all,

I'm rotating off release duty this cycle. Role-based access on the Lanternmoss wiki is now enforced: release managers hold the `rm-core` role, which gates the deploy page and the signing workflow. Everything else is documented on the Access page. For continuity, the deploy key you'll need is included below.

release key, fahaf-bajof: bky3_Xam

Hi all — quick rundown for branch managers. Revenue held steady, but margins in the Freight Solutions division slipped for the third straight quarter, so we're pausing all hiring there until further notice. Existing offers will be honoured; backfills need sign-off from Finance. Other divisions aren't affected, so please don't spread panic. We'll revisit in January once the Marbeck contract renewal lands. Questions go to your regional finance partner. The confidential note on where we're heading follows below.

board note of fahag-tajop: The eastern region missed its Julix quota by 44.0 percent last quarter. Ralionax Holdings plans to lower the Druath list price by 61.8 percent in March. The board signed off on a budget of $295.0 million for Project Gilath. The renewal with Ruswynix Systems closes at $274.5 million a year, 17.0 percent above the last contract.

### Ticket #4417: Config drift on Bookbarrow import

Hey reviewer — staging and prod have drifted again on the Bookbarrow catalogue importer. Batch size, dedupe mode, and the retry ceiling all differ, which explains the flaky nightly run. Please sanity-check the diff before I force-sync. For reference, the intended canonical values are pasted below.

deployment values, tafog-kagap:
wenath:
  pin: 4244
  metrics_host: metrics.wenath.lumicsys.internal
  tenant: istix
  seal: seal_10585894

Finance Review Summary — Tarnwell Reseller Programme

Prepared for the incoming director. The programme contributed 18% of quarterly revenue, with partner rebates tracking slightly above forecast. Receivables from the Ellmere cluster warrant closer monitoring. Audit found controls adequate but recommended quarterly partner reconciliations. Full workpapers are filed with the Quorva team. The confidential planning context is set out immediately below.

confidential, kagup-bafog: Fraaxax Group is in early talks to buy Soroxox Group for about $343.8 million. The Olidor launch date is June 14, and nothing goes to the press before then. Legal wants the Aldmirek Logistics term sheet signed before July 23.